Google Earth nie wyświetla mapy

8

Mam taki sam problem, jak tutaj opisany , ale na to pytanie nie ma odpowiedzi, a jego OP nie wydaje się, że kiedykolwiek odpowie na powstałe pytania.

Zainstalowałem google-earth-pro-stable_current_amd64.debprzez sudo apt installUbuntu 16.04 64 bit.

Usunięcie ~/.xinputrcniczego nie zmieniło. Kiedy loguję się na inne konto (konto na moim komputerze, to znaczy - nie sądzę, że komentator miał na myśli inne konto Google (nie zalogowałem się na żadne konto Google)), mam dokładnie ten sam problem.

To nie jest jak usterka, która pojawia się przez kilka sekund, a następnie znika. Google Earth po prostu nie nadaje się do użycia, ponieważ mapa nigdy się nie wyświetla. Zawsze pokazuje elementy sterujące, część ekranu powitalnego i wszystko , co było w tle, gdy aplikacja została uruchomiona.

Co pojawia się po uruchomieniu Google Earth:

ttf-mscorefonts-installer już został zainstalowany.

Korzystanie gdebirównież nie rozwiązało problemu.

Nie używano też wersji 32-bitowej.

UTF-8
źródło
Po zainstalowaniu .debz Google wypróbowałem również grafikę w trybie awaryjnym, ale bezskutecznie.
carnendil
Wydaje się też, że jest to duplikat askubuntu.com/q/956464/58950, który, choć może wydawać się porzucony, ma zaledwie miesiąc.
carnendil
@carnendil Odniosłem się do tego pytania w pierwszym akapicie. Nie widziałem jednak, że jest „tylko” porzucony na miesiąc, ale na rok. Jakoś odczytałem datę jako „wrzesień 2016 r.”, A nie „16 września”.
UTF-8
Myślałem też, że po raz pierwszy „wrzesień 2016” :). Dlatego „duplikat” skomentowałem dopiero później. Nie znalazłem jeszcze rozwiązania na pytanie.
carnendil
@ UTF-8, mam ten sam problem, nawet instalacja wersji 32-bitowej nie działała. Chciałem zadać to jako osobne pytanie, ale stwierdziłem, że to pytanie ma dokładnie to, co chciałem zadać. Jeśli już znalazłeś rozwiązanie, odpowiedz na własne pytanie, jeśli nie, mam nadzieję, że osoby przeglądające to będą w stanie wkrótce znaleźć rozwiązanie.
Kewal Shah

Odpowiedzi:

12

Znalazłem rozwiązanie problemu:

Znajdź aktualnie zainstalowany pakiet Google Earth

dpkg --list 'google-earth*'

Odinstaluj istniejący pakiet:

sudo dpkg -P google-earth-stable

Zainstaluj pakiet googleearth :

sudo apt-get install googleearth-package

Użyj skryptu, aby pobrać najnowszą wersję binarną i utworzyć pakiet .deb :

make-googleearth-package --force

Przykład wiadomości, którą powinieneś otrzymać po wykonaniu powyższego polecenia:

Description: Google Earth, a 3D map/planet viewer
 Package built with googleearth-package.
dpkg-deb: building package 'googleearth' in './googleearth_6.0.3.2197+1.2.0-1_amd64.deb'.
-----------------------------
Success!
You can now install the package with e.g:

sudo dpkg -i googleearth_6.0.3.2197+1.2.0-1_amd64.deb
-----------------------------

Zainstaluj pakiet .deb zgodnie z opisem:

sudo dpkg -i googleearth_6.0.3.2197+1.2.0-1_amd64.deb

W przypadku pojawienia się jakichkolwiek problemów związanych z zależnościami (co miało miejsce w moim przypadku), użyj

sudo apt-get -f install

Pomyślnie zainstaluje kompatybilną wersję Google Earth dla twojego systemu.

Oto, jak teraz wygląda Google Earth:

(W przeciwieństwie do tego, jak to wyglądało na moim komputerze, jak pokazano w pytaniu)

Jak powinno teraz wyglądać

Uwaga: Ta metoda zadziałała dla mnie, mam nadzieję, że zadziała również u Ciebie :)

(odniesienie: https://help.ubuntu.com/community/GoogleEarth )

Kewal Shah
źródło
Czy istnieje podobne rozwiązanie dla najnowszej wersji GE 7.3?
s6hebern
@ s6hebern Nie wiem, przepraszam!
Kewal Shah,
2
Google nie publikuje już pliku instalacyjnego http://dl.google.com/earth/client/current/GoogleEarthLinux.bin wymaganego przez ten skrypt.
Serge Stroobandt
Obecnie (2019-06-11) jedynym sposobem na uruchomienie Google Earth Pro w takim przypadku jest odinstalowanie jego najnowszej wersji, a następnie pobranie google-earth-pro-stable_7.1.8.3036-r0_amd64.debbezpośrednio z oficjalnego repozytorium Google ( dl.google.com/linux/earth/deb/pool/ main / g /… ) i wreszcie go instaluję. Jeśli np. gdebiZainstalowałeś ( sudo apt-get install gdebi -y) i zapisałeś taki pakiet DEB w /tmp, po prostu uruchom sudo gdebi -n /tmp/google-earth-pro-stable_7.1.8.3036-r0_amd64.debi możesz iść.
Yuri Sucupira,
4

Opcja 1: Zainstaluj starszą wersję Google Earth Pro

Najnowsze wersje google-earth-pronie są zgodne ze sterownikami GNU / Linux dla nowszego sprzętu graficznego.

Odinstaluj najnowszą google-earth-prowersję, a następnie pobierz i zainstaluj google-earth-pro-stable_7.1.8.3036-r0_amd64.debz oficjalnego lub prywatnego repozytorium kopii zapasowych , zgodnie z sugestią tutaj .

W Menedżerze pakietów Synaptic wybierz Packages→, Lock Versionaby zapobiec przyszłej aktualizacji.

Opcja 2: Ustawienie trybu DDX

Jeśli xserver-xorg-video-intelpakiet jest używany, a zintegrowana grafika Intel jest raczej nowa, po prostu odinstaluj go i uruchom ponownie.

$ sudo apt remove xserver-xorg-video-intel

Jak wyjaśnia informacja dostarczona ze sterownikiem:

Używanie tego sterownika jest odradzane, jeśli twój sprzęt jest wystarczająco nowy (ok. 2007 i nowsze). Możesz spróbować odinstalować ten sterownik i pozwolić serwerowi użyć wbudowanego sterownika do ustawiania trybów.

Zastrzeżenie 2 opcji

Niestety, ustawianie trybu DDX psuje wiele innych rzeczy:

Zobacz także archlinux.org .

Serge Stroobandt
źródło
1
Dziękuję Ci! Nigdy nie spotkałbym się z tym, że „odradzam” na własną rękę, a to naprawiło zarówno Google Earth, jak i 3D w mojej przeglądarce. Druga odpowiedź wcale nie pomogła, ale ta jest idealna.
Brandon Rhodes,
1
Doskonała odpowiedź. To zadziałało dla mnie (wybrałem opcję 2). Dziękuję bardzo.
A. Stroh
1
Przynajmniej do 11.06.2019 nadal można pobrać google-earth-pro-stable_7.1.8.3036-r0_amd64.debbezpośrednio z oficjalnego repozytorium Google: dl.google.com/linux/earth/deb/pool/main/g/…
Yuri Sucupira